Australian equities experienced a sharp downturn in early trading, reflecting global market reactions to recent policy shifts in the United States. Broad declines were observed across most industry sectors, with only essential consumer businesses showing stability. The broader ASX 200 recorded a notable decline, aligning with global trends.
Energy Sector Faces Supply Concerns
Energy-related businesses encountered some of the steepest declines as concerns over global supply disruptions took center stage. The market response reflects uncertainty surrounding future trade developments and their effects on commodity pricing. With a shifting trade landscape, companies operating in this segment have faced heightened pressures.
Trade Adjustments and Market Sentiment
Newly imposed tariffs on American imports have led to widespread reactions among international stakeholders. While certain industries have seen more pronounced effects, Australian exports remain relatively insulated due to limited direct exposure to the US market. Nonetheless, any prolonged uncertainty could influence broader economic conditions and investor sentiment.
